Welcome to Dolan Springs ...

Dolan Springs is located in Mohave County<1>.



A typical abbreviation for Dolan Springs: Dolan Spgs. (or less commonly used: Dolan Spngs. or Dolan Sprngs.)

Dolan Springs is 3,360 feet [1,024 m] above sea level.<2> In other words, the altitude of Dolan Springs is about ¾ mile [or ~1 km] above sea level.

Time Zone: Dolan Springs lies in the Mountain Standard Time Zone (MST) and does not observe daylight saving time

Note: If you leave Dolan Springs and travel west, you will leave Mountain Standard Time and cross into the Pacific Time Zone (PST/PDT). In addition, you will be moving from an area that does not observe daylight saving time to one that does.

Dolan Springs is located in the (928) area code.

The ZIP code for Dolan Springs: 86441<3>
